Weather report for Cyprus from August 20 to August 23, 2026

Between August 20 and August 23, 2026, Cyprus experienced varied summer weather conditions. Temperatures fluctuated significantly, peaking on Friday, August 21, when inland temperatures reached approximately 41 degrees Celsius, before cooling to 39 degrees Celsius over the weekend. Coastal areas maintained milder temperatures, ranging between 30 and 36 degrees Celsius, while mountainous regions consistently stayed cooler at approximately 29 to 32 degrees Celsius.

Meteorological reports indicated mostly clear skies throughout the period, with localized cloud development occurring primarily in the afternoons over mountainous regions. Winds generally blew at 3 Beaufort, occasionally strengthening to 4 or 5 Beaufort along the coasts during the afternoon hours. Sea conditions remained largely calm to slightly rough, particularly on windward coasts during periods of stronger wind activity.

Looking ahead, the forecast for the beginning of the week, specifically Monday and Tuesday, indicates mainly clear weather. However, the Department of Meteorology has warned of potential light fog and mist forming in inland and southeastern areas during the early morning hours, as temperatures are expected to stabilize.
